The Current State of Sports Business in India

  • Cricket Dominance: Cricket remains the unrivaled king of sports in India. The Indian Premier League (IPL), a professional Twenty20 cricket league, has played a pivotal role in elevating cricket to a grand spectacle. The IPL has attracted massive investments, global viewership, and sponsorships, making it one of the most lucrative sporting leagues in the world.
  • Emerging Sports: Beyond cricket, sports like kabaddi, football, badminton, and wrestling have gained substantial popularity. Leagues like the Pro Kabaddi League (PKL) and the Indian Super League (ISL) have successfully carved a niche in the Indian sports landscape.
  • Infrastructure and Facilities: Investments in sports infrastructure have witnessed significant growth. World-class stadiums, training academies, and fitness centers are emerging across the country.

Key Statistics and Trends

  • Economic Impact: The sports industry in India is estimated to contribute over $7 billion to the country’s GDP, with substantial growth projected in the coming years.
  • Media Rights: Media rights and broadcasting deals are major revenue streams for sports businesses. In 2018, the IPL’s media rights were sold for a staggering $2.55 billion for five years.
  • Sponsorships: Leading companies are increasingly investing in sports sponsorships to leverage the vast viewership. Cricket endorsements alone contribute to billions of dollars in annual brand deals.
  • Sports Tech: The emergence of sports technology startups is revolutionizing the industry. From fitness apps to data analytics for sports teams, technology is playing a pivotal role.

The Future of Sports Business in India

  • Diversification of Sports: As other sports continue to grow, diversification will be a key trend. Leagues, academies, and grassroots initiatives will promote a wider range of sports, nurturing talent across various disciplines.
  • Investment in Sports Infrastructure: Expect a continued surge in investments in sports infrastructure. State-of-the-art stadiums, training centers, and sports science facilities will become more commonplace.
  • Digital Transformation: The digital revolution will drive fan engagement, content creation, and data analytics in sports. Virtual reality, augmented reality, and immersive fan experiences will gain prominence.
  • International Sporting Events: India is actively bidding for hosting major international sporting events like the FIFA World Cup and the Olympic Games. These events could usher in a new era of sports business in the country.

Leading Companies in Indian Sports Business

  • Reliance Industries Limited: Through its subsidiary, Reliance Industries has made substantial investments in the sports business, including ownership of the Mumbai Indians IPL team and the development of sports infrastructure.
  • Mashal Sports: The company behind the Pro Kabaddi League (PKL), Mashal Sports has transformed kabaddi into a marketable and televised sport in India.
  • IMG-Reliance: A joint venture between IMG and Reliance Industries, IMG-Reliance has played a pivotal role in the development of Indian football through the Indian Super League (ISL).
  • Star Sports: As the official broadcaster of the IPL and various other sporting events, Star Sports is a major player in the sports media and broadcasting sector in India.
